At the AI Adoption Initiative and Carnegie Mellon University’s upcoming workshop, AI Upskilling: The Future of Work in the Age of AI, discussions will draw on The AI Labor Stack: Rethinking the Workforce from the Ground Up, a pre-read to AI Adoption, Upskilling, and Workforce Transformation in the Global Economy.
The papers explore how governments, employers, and education systems can best prepare workers for the opportunities and disruptions created by AI adoption. They introduce the concept of the “AI Labor Stack,” which groups workers into innovators, facilitators, and users, and argues that successful AI strategies require investment in skills across all three groups.
